The Basics Behind the Controversy
Many health providers highly recommend taking fish oil as a supplement during pregnancy, while others avoid it at all costs. Just whom should you pay attention to? As a student midwife myself, I have done a lot of research on this topic and can tell you truthfully: whether or not you take fish oil as part of your pregnancy diet depends mainly on the brand you use.Generic brands of fish oil supplements have been known to contain mercury, a heavy metal that is dangerous for anyone, much less for a developing baby. They are not as stringently monitored and checked to ensure that the dangerous chemicals and heavy metals are taken out of the oil.
Pharmaceutical grade fish oil is the best. Generally the oils that are pharmaceutical quality are molecularly-distilled. To produce this high of quality oil, the crude fish oil is put under an extreme vacuum, where it can boil at very low temperatures. As it is boiled off, the contaminants are boiled off by weight. Each healthy part of the fish oil, such as EPA or DHA compounds are distilled to a different location than the heavy metals and other dangerous substances are. Using molecular distillation ensures that each molecule of healthy fish oil is distilled into the holding tanks while the substances with higher boiling points (that the oil never reaches)--mercury, PB, and dioxins--remain in the pot. This process ensures that you and your baby are getting the healthiest and safest oil possible.

Benefits of Using a Prenatal Fish Oil Supplement
With all the hype surrounding fish oil these days, you might know about fish oil supplements, and then you might not. It is worth knowing; fish oil is known for many benefits. Let's start with the benefits that the mother gains. Of course, the oil is excellent for your skin, hair, and nails. This is because it is so rich in protein and Omega 3s, strengthening and hydrating all three. Omega 3s also benefits your thinking capabilities by helping your neurons fire better. Cardiovascular system, too, reap great rewards when you take fish oil supplements. It helps your arteries stay soft and pliant, feeds the heart, and offers a host of other blessings.But what about the baby? If the generic brands are so bad for that little one, what about the high-quality oils? Studies have shown that taking pharmaceutical grade fish oil during pregnancy help the baby's brain growth and nervous system progress. In addition, preliminary studies suggest that taking this supplement also helps the baby develop sleeping patterns quicker after birth. It also helps a mother's milk to stay rich and full of nourishment for the little one. Indeed, from antenatal development through the first year, a mother's intake of a high quality fish oil is very beneficial to the baby.
